| Problem | Solution | |--------|----------| | “No update file found” | Ensure the folder is named exactly xiaomi (lowercase) and the ZIP is inside. Try a different USB port. | | “Signature verification failed” | You have the wrong region firmware. Double-check model number. | | Recovery mode won’t appear | Try holding (for some variants) instead of OK+Back. Or use a wired USB keyboard. | | TV stuck on boot logo | Perform a factory reset from recovery mode (wipes data). | | Update stops at 50% | The USB drive is corrupted. Use another drive (older, smaller capacity works best). |
